首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

SED:在同一行中的两个模式之间插入单词/字符串

SED,全称为Stream Editor,是一种流编辑器,用于处理文本流。它可以对文本进行插入、删除、替换、查找等操作,常用于对大型文件进行批量处理。

在同一行中的两个模式之间插入单词或字符串的操作可以通过SED的替换命令实现。替换命令的语法为:

代码语言:txt
复制
s/模式/替换字符串/

其中,模式指定了需要匹配的文本,可以使用正则表达式进行模式匹配;替换字符串是想要插入的单词或字符串。

下面是一个示例:

代码语言:txt
复制
sed 's/pattern/inserted string/' filename

以上命令会将文件中匹配到的第一个模式pattern替换为插入的字符串inserted string。如果想要替换所有匹配到的模式,可以在替换命令的末尾添加"g"选项:

代码语言:txt
复制
sed 's/pattern/inserted string/g' filename

SED在文本处理中具有广泛的应用场景,比如批量替换文本、删除指定行或字符、添加行号等操作。腾讯云提供了云服务器(CVM)产品,可用于进行文本处理的任务。您可以通过以下链接了解更多关于腾讯云云服务器的信息: https://cloud.tencent.com/product/cvm

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券